I have read through all of the documents that I have received in preparation of the meeting.
I found it interesting to read about what the EC discussed and what is happening within the Midlands.
The members of the USDAW Midlands Divisional Council will also be required to agree on Eight nominees to send to the USDAW Summer School series one and Six nominees for the USDAW Summer School series two.

I have read through all the applications received and I have made a list of people who in my opinion would benefit from attending the USDAW Summer Schools.
I would say a personal thank you to every applicant. I have attended both USDAW Summer Schools series one - 2008 and series 2 - 2009 and I really enjoyed them. They are a great experience and really help you to understand more about USDAW.
The Women Chainmakers festival is taking place on Sunday 12th July - Cradley Heath High Street, Cradley Heath, Sandwell, B64 5HJ.
The Midlands region is asking branches to make a donation towards the event.
The Divisional officer Gavin Dadley hopes that the Midlands branches can raise at least £1000 for the event and encourages as many members, Reps and there families attend this important event.
